Protein pickle dip
Portions: 6
Ingredients:
- 1 cup of mixed cottage cheese
- 1/2 cup plain not -fed Greek yogurt
- 1/2 cup chopped dill pickles
- 1 tbsp. or more pickle juice
- 1 tsp. lemon juice
- 1 handful of chopped fresh dill
- 3 or 4 chopped chives
- Sprinkle ranch spices, to taste (contains salt)
- Pinch of salt and pepper, to taste
- 1/2 tsp. Garlic powder
- 1/2 tsp. onion powder
- 1/4 cup fried onion
Instructions:
- Mix the base: In a medium bowl, stir together the mixed cottage cheese and Greek yogurt until it is smooth.
- Add flavor: Fold the chopped pickles, chives, dill, pickle juice, lemon juice, garlic powder, onion powder, ranch spices, salt and pepper. Mix well to combine. Cover and refrigerator for at least 1 hour to allow the flavors to merge. If dip seems too thick after cooling, stir in more pickle juice to reach your desired consistency.
- Finish and serve: Before serving, top dipped with fried onions, a few extra chopped pickles and a sprinkle of fresh dill. Serve with your favorite raw vegetables or chips.

Nutrition per Portion:
Calories: 72; Total fat: 2g; Saturated fat: 1g; Single -Saturated Fat: 0g; Cholesterol: 71 mg; Sodium: 500 mg; Carbohydrate: 5g; Diet Fiber: 0g; Sugar: 2g; Protein: 6g
